Charge Posts: 205

@ Jordan17:

The newer SE phones have a message limit of 1000 messages unless I'm mistaken.

And you can check how many messages by:

Filemanager -> More -> Memory status.

Scroll down... the number of SMS messages currently stored is shown.

(Works on my Z550i. Should work on your phone.)
